How will it work?

Simulate the impact o environmentalactors on your design, such as daylightand shadow.

Modeled in Autodesk® Ecotect™ Analysissotware.

The ability to see what a project will look like beore it is built

only the beginning. Digital models can also depict how a projwill behave in the real world.

In the past, design problems were discovered only ater the design was built,resulting in costly redesign and manuacture. The ability to see what theproject will actually do beore it is created helps customers to identiy andcorrect potential deects early in the design process.

For example, a designer can analyze design concepts such as basic orm andbuilding orientation to determine the optimal location o a building basedon environmental actors such as daylight, overshadowing, solar access, andvisual impact.

How well will it work?

Where simulation captures a project’s behavior in the real wodigital model can help designers analyze that behavior and prthat project’s perormance—and then measure it.

It’s better than the real thing because manuacturers can measure the strengtho their products and how they will respond to the various stress levels o everyday use. By putting a video game controller through its paces virtually,they can break it, rebuild it, and keep doing it until it’s perect—withoutbuilding it rst.

Architecture, Engineering, and ConstructionBuilding Inormation Modeling enables architects, engineers, builders,and owners to explore a digital project’s key characteristics such as cost,scheduling, and environmental impact—beore the project is actually built.

Rendered in Autodesk Alias. Modelcourtesy o Paulin Motor Company AB.

Automotive and TransportationAutomotive manuacturers and suppliers use the Autodesk solution orDigital Prototyping to design, model, test, and market products beorebuilding them.

KungFu Panda™&© 2008DreamWorks Animation L.L.C.AllRights Reserved.

Media and EntertainmentWhether in lm, video games, or television, Autodesk provides digitalartists and animators with technologies that are redening digitalcontent creation. 

Modeled in Autodesk 3ds Max.Image courtesy o Genesis-design GmbH.

ManuacturingFrom industrial machinery to consumer products, the Autodesk solution orDigital Prototyping helps manuacturers accelerate product launches andoptimize global supply chain collaboration by connecting all phases o theproduct development process without the need or a physical prototype.

Image modeled in Autodesk 3ds Max.

Utilities and TelecommunicationsUtilities and telecommunications providers are using Autodesk InrastructureModeling tools to more easily handle customer requests, respond quickly tooutages, and eectively provide inormation or reporting and decision analysis.

GovernmentAutodesk products and solutions enable both ederal and stato meet crucial obje ctives such as replacing and rebuilding ainrastructure while acing the challenges o shrinking budgechanging regulations.
